How you can make a difference
Reporting to the Director of Technology Services, the Major Incident Management Coordinator will be required to lead incident response efforts and communications. The role will require the candidate to write for various communications channels, which may include email, intranet, status pages, and communications calendars. This role is pivotal for maintaining open communication lines during incident response. Strong organization and written communication skills are needed as the position requires working cross functionally with all departments.
What you'll be doing
- Act as the primary point of contact for all Major Incidents, ensuring swift and effective communication with relevant stakeholders.
- Coordinate with technical teams to gather accurate and timely information regarding incident status and potential resolution paths.
- Draft, refine, and distribute formal incident communications, ensuring clarity, accuracy, and a tone appropriate for high visibility communications.
- Manage and monitor communications channels to ensure all parties are informed and up to date.
- Lead post incident review meetings, ensuring lessons learned are documented and action items are assigned and tracked.
- Maintain and improve the incident communication protocol, ensuring it remains effective and meets the needs of the business.

What you will need to be successful
- Ability to work both independently and with other teams and departments.
- Bachelor's degree in IT, Business, English, communications, or equivalent work experience (4-6 years).
- Excellent formal written communication with the ability to craft custom messages for high visibility scenarios.
- Ability to remain calm under pressure and manage stressful situations effectively.
- Prioritize and balance a variety of assignments simultaneously.
- Experience with on-call rotations and a willingness to participate as required.
- Project management and decision-making skills.
- SCRUM & Agile experience with the ability to lead agile ceremonies.
